About Kenichi Kuboya
Kenichi Kuboya is a Japanese golfer who primarily plays on the Japan Golf Tour. He turned professional in 1995 and as of August 2009 had carded four tournament victories; two in 1997 and two in 2002. He played on the PGA Tour for one season in 2003, but could not maintain his tour card.

Personal Information

Kuboya was born March 11, 1972, in Kanagawa, Japan. He attended college at Meiji University in Tokyo. Kuboya stands 5 feet, 9 inches tall and weighs 150 pounds.

Tournament Victories

Kuboya has prevailed in four tournaments during his career: the Daikyo Open and Fujisankei Classic in 1997, and the Munsingwear Open KSB Cup and Japan PGA Championship in 2002. All four tournaments are part of the Japan Golf Tour.

Major Championships

Kuboya has played in two major championships during his career. His first was at the British Open Championship in 2002, where he made the cut but was not a factor during the final rounds. His second major championship was in 2009, when he finished tied for 27th place at the British Open Championship. During that tournament, he fired a 65 during the first round, was the leader during the second day and won nearly $48,000.

Highlights

During the course of his career, Kuboya has carded some impressive scores. Four times, he has needed nine putts to complete nine holes, and one two occasions has used 20 putts over the course of 18 holes. During an event in 2002, he scored 10 birdies during a single round. His lowest stroke count for 18 holes is 63, which he accomplished in both 2002 and 2004.

PGA Tour

Kuboya played an entire season on the PGA Tour in 2003. His best finish was for 13th at the 84 Lumber Classic of Pennsylvania. His finishes that season were not high enough to keep his tour card, and he returned to the Japan Golf Tour in 2004.
